What are the responsibilities and job description for the Project Scheduler position at Spencer Ogden?
Job Description:
- Organize, implement, and maintain project scheduling management systems to support assigned projects and programs.
- Develop and maintain detailed project schedules in Primavera P6, including task creation, status updates, and schedule reporting.
- Coordinate with project staff, stakeholders, superintendents, field engineers, and contractors to define scope, schedule work activities, and manage assignments.
- Analyze schedule performance, evaluate progress against baseline plans, identify variances, and recommend corrective actions or recovery plans for delayed activities.
- Perform critical path analysis and assess schedule constraints to determine impacts of project changes and identify alternative work sequences.
- Develop and update weekly schedules while supporting change management processes, procedures, and systems throughout the project lifecycle.
- Prepare and maintain periodic project status reports to provide management with accurate updates on schedule performance and project progress.
- Collaborate with project managers, cost engineers, contractors, and other team members to ensure effective project execution and reporting.
Preferred Qualifications:
- PMP or other PMI certifications are preferred but not required.
- PSP, CST, or other AACE International certifications are considered a plus.
- Knowledge of schedule quality best practices and standards related to Primavera P6 schedules is preferred.
- Familiarity with project gating procedures and stage-gate processes is beneficial.
- Previous experience supporting Gas Storage projects is considered an asset.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Excel for schedule analysis, reporting, and data management.
